More information
S/Sgt John W. Daley enlisted in Cincinnati, Ohio on 20 July 1942.He was first buried at the Temporary American Military Cemetery in Grand Failly, France.
He is remembered at the Mount Moriah Cemetery in Philadelphia, Philadelphia County, Pennsylvania.
